Sustainability Assessment of Chemical Processes: Evaluation of Three Synthesis Routes of DMC

Table 4

Process description for Route B.

Process unitTypeConditionsNotes

Reac 1Stoichiometric reactor = 100°C, = 140 barConversion of propylene oxide = 100%
Reac 2Stoichiometric reactor = 150°C, = 1 barConversion of methanol = 5.25%
Col 1 RadFrac column15 stages, distillate rate = 2, reflux ratio = 5Separation of propylene carbonate
Col 2RadFrac column15 stages, distillate rate = 1.895, reflux ratio = 5Separation of methanol
Col 3RadFrac column15 stages, distillate rate = 0.06, reflux ratio = 5Concentration of DMC after distillation = 85.9%
CondCooler = 20°C, = 1 barCooling of DMC
